| Description | FluidSynth is a software synthesizer based on the SoundFont 2 specifications. From 2.5.0 until 2.5.6, the native DLS parser validates articulation chunks using the unsigned expression cbsize + connblocks * 12 without first ensuring that the multiplication and addition fit in 32 bits. A crafted DLS file can supply a large connblocks value that wraps the expression and bypasses the chunk-size check, after which the parser performs approximately one billion 12-byte iterations beyond the chunk boundary. The excessive processing and invalid reads can cause denial of service. Builds with the CMake option enable-native-dls set to OFF do not expose the parser. This issue is fixed in version 2.5.6. | |
| Title | FluidSynth: DLS Articulation Chunk Integer Overflow | |
| Weaknesses | CWE-190 | |
